Eco-Friendly Stonework Materials



Using environmentally friendly masonry materials is a pivotal step towards boosting the sustainability of building and construction practices and reducing environmental effect while making best use of lasting financial advantages. Lasting stonework materials are sourced, generated, and utilized in a way that reduces overall environmental influence. Products such as recycled bricks, reclaimed rock, and lasting concrete blocks are becoming increasingly preferred options for eco-conscious building contractors. Recycled blocks, for instance, not just draw away waste from garbage dumps but additionally need less power to create compared to new bricks. Recovered stone supplies an unique visual charm while lowering the need for new quarrying. Lasting concrete blocks incorporate recycled aggregates and might include enhanced insulation homes, contributing to energy performance in structures.


Furthermore, all-natural products like adobe, rammed earth, and straw bales give exceptional thermal mass homes, decreasing the demand for home heating and cooling energy. These products are commonly locally available, advertising regional economies and reducing transportation-related carbon exhausts. By choosing green masonry materials, building projects can considerably minimize their environmental footprint and add to the creation of healthier, extra lasting built settings.




Energy-Efficient Masonry Methods



Power effectiveness plays an essential role in boosting the sustainability of stonework building techniques. By implementing energy-efficient masonry techniques, building contractors can dramatically decrease the total power intake of a structure, causing lower functional expenses and a smaller ecological impact. One crucial energy-efficient masonry technique is making use Click Here of thermal mass, which includes incorporating dense products like concrete or brick right into the structure's framework to take in and store warmth. This assists control indoor temperature levels, lowering the demand for mechanical home heating and cooling down systems.

Additionally, correct insulation is vital for energy performance in masonry building and construction. Shielding materials such as inflexible foam boards or mineral wool can be set up within masonry walls to lessen heat loss and boost the building's total power performance. Additionally, strategic placement of home windows and shading gadgets can enhance natural light and air flow, minimizing the dependence on fabricated lights and HVAC systems.




Technologies in Sustainable Stonework



 


Recent developments in lasting stonework techniques have caused ingenious techniques that are improving the building and construction industry. One such advancement is the growth of self-healing concrete, which makes use of germs installed within the concrete to recover fractures autonomously. This innovation not only decreases upkeep costs however likewise enhances the resilience of stonework frameworks, adding to their sustainability.
